1. Cutting Boards as Decor

Cutting boards aren’t just for chopping vegetables – they can also serve as beautiful and functional decor pieces. Consider displaying a collection of wooden cutting boards in various shapes and sizes against your backsplash. Not only will this add visual interest to your countertops, but it will also keep your most-used boards within easy reach.

Pro tip: Opt for cutting boards made from sustainable materials like bamboo or reclaimed wood for an eco-friendly touch.

2. Herb Gardens

Bring a touch of nature into your kitchen by creating a small herb garden on your countertop. Plant your favorite herbs in stylish pots or mason jars and arrange them near a sunny window. Not only will this add a fresh pop of green to your space, but you’ll also have easy access to fresh herbs for cooking.

Some herbs that thrive in indoor gardens include:

  • Basil
  • Mint
  • Rosemary
  • Thyme
  • Cilantro

3. Decorative Trays

Trays are a versatile decor piece that can help you keep your countertops organized while adding a stylish touch. Use a tray to corral frequently used items like oils, spices, or coffee supplies. You can also use trays to display decorative items like candles, vases, or small plants.

Pro tip: Look for trays with unique textures or patterns to add visual interest to your countertops.

Say goodbye to cluttered countertops and hello to sleek storage with a set of statement canisters. Use them to store dry goods like flour, sugar, and coffee beans, or fill them with utensils and cooking tools. Look for canisters in materials that complement your kitchen’s style, such as ceramic, glass, or stainless steel.

5. Cookbook Display

If you’re a passionate home cook, chances are you have a collection of beloved cookbooks. Why not display them on your countertop? Choose a stylish cookbook stand or create a small stack of your favorites. Not only will this keep your cookbooks within easy reach, but it will also add a personal touch to your kitchen decor.

6. Fruit Bowls

A bowl of fresh fruit is a classic kitchen decor piece that is both beautiful and functional. Choose a bowl that complements your kitchen’s style and fill it with your favorite fruits. Not only will this add a pop of color to your countertops, but it will also encourage healthy snacking.

Pro tip: Look for bowls with unique shapes or textures to add visual interest to your countertops.

7. Kitchen Linens

Kitchen linens like dish towels and oven mitts can serve as both functional and decorative pieces. Choose linens in colors and patterns that complement your kitchen’s style and display them on hooks or in a basket on your countertop. Not only will this keep them within easy reach, but it will also add a cozy touch to your space.

8. Decorative Utensil Holders

Keep your most-used cooking utensils organized and within easy reach with a decorative utensil holder. Look for holders in materials that complement your kitchen’s style, such as ceramic, wood, or stainless steel. You can also get creative and repurpose items like mason jars or vintage crocks as utensil holders.

Your kitchen countertops are the perfect place to display a piece of art that reflects your personal style. Choose a piece that complements your kitchen’s color scheme and hang it above your countertops or lean it against your backsplash. You can also create a gallery wall with a collection of smaller pieces.

Pro tip: Look for art pieces that are moisture and heat-resistant to ensure they will hold up in the kitchen environment.

10. Coffee Station

If you’re a coffee lover, consider creating a dedicated coffee station on your countertop. Include all of your coffee-making essentials, such as your coffee maker, mugs, and coffee beans. You can also add decorative elements like a tray or a chalkboard sign with your favorite coffee quotes.

11. Spice Racks

Spices are a kitchen essential, but they can quickly clutter up your countertops if not properly organized. Consider investing in a stylish spice rack to keep your spices within easy reach and add a decorative touch to your space. You can opt for a traditional wall-mounted rack or get creative with magnetic tins or a revolving spice tower.

12. Decorative Appliances

Your small kitchen appliances, like your toaster or stand mixer, can serve as both functional and decorative pieces. Look for appliances in colors or finishes that complement your kitchen’s style and display them proudly on your countertops. You can also use appliance covers to hide less attractive appliances when not in use.

Pro tip: Invest in high-quality appliances that will last for years and add value to your kitchen.
